如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

SMTP-AUTH认证:确保邮件传输安全的关键技术

SMTP-AUTH认证:确保邮件传输安全的关键技术

在现代互联网通信中,电子邮件仍然是不可或缺的交流工具。然而,随着网络安全问题的日益突出,确保邮件传输的安全性变得尤为重要。SMTP-AUTH认证就是这样一种技术,它通过验证发送者的身份来防止未经授权的邮件发送,保护用户的邮箱不被滥用。

什么是SMTP-AUTH认证?

SMTP-AUTH认证(Simple Mail Transfer Protocol Authentication)是SMTP协议的一个扩展,旨在通过身份验证来增强邮件传输的安全性。传统的SMTP协议在设计时并没有考虑到身份验证的问题,这导致了垃圾邮件和邮件伪造的泛滥。SMTP-AUTH通过在邮件发送过程中要求发送者提供用户名和密码来解决这一问题。

SMTP-AUTH的工作原理

当一个用户尝试通过SMTP服务器发送邮件时,服务器会要求用户提供身份验证信息。常见的验证方法包括:

  1. 用户名/密码认证:这是最基本的认证方式,用户需要提供正确的用户名和密码。

  2. CRAM-MD5:一种基于挑战-响应的认证机制,服务器发送一个随机字符串,客户端使用这个字符串和密码生成一个MD5哈希值返回。

  3. PLAIN:直接在网络上传输用户名和密码,通常与TLS/SSL加密结合使用以确保安全。

  4. LOGIN:类似于PLAIN,但分两步发送用户名和密码。

SMTP-AUTH的应用场景

  1. 企业邮件系统:许多企业使用内部邮件服务器来管理员工的邮件通信。通过SMTP-AUTH认证,可以确保只有授权的员工能够发送邮件,防止内部邮件系统被外部人员滥用。

  2. 个人邮箱服务:像Gmail、Outlook等个人邮箱服务提供商都使用SMTP-AUTH来保护用户的邮箱安全,防止垃圾邮件发送者利用用户的邮箱发送垃圾邮件。

  3. 邮件营销:合法邮件营销公司需要通过SMTP-AUTH来验证其发送邮件的合法性,避免被标记为垃圾邮件。

  4. ISP(互联网服务提供商):ISP提供的邮件服务也依赖于SMTP-AUTH来确保用户的邮件安全。

SMTP-AUTH的优势

  • 防止垃圾邮件:通过验证发送者的身份,减少了垃圾邮件的发送。
  • 保护用户隐私:防止未经授权的访问和邮件伪造。
  • 提高邮件传输的可靠性:只有经过验证的邮件才会被接受,减少了邮件丢失或被拒收的风险。
  • 符合法律法规:许多国家和地区的法律要求邮件服务提供商采取措施防止垃圾邮件,SMTP-AUTH是其中的一种有效手段。

SMTP-AUTH的挑战

尽管SMTP-AUTH带来了诸多好处,但也存在一些挑战:

  • 用户体验:用户需要记住额外的认证信息,可能增加使用难度。
  • 安全性:如果认证信息泄露,可能会导致安全问题。
  • 兼容性:并非所有邮件客户端或服务器都支持所有类型的SMTP-AUTH认证方法。

结论

SMTP-AUTH认证作为一种增强邮件传输安全性的技术,已经被广泛应用于各种邮件服务中。它不仅保护了用户的邮箱安全,还在一定程度上减少了垃圾邮件的泛滥。尽管存在一些挑战,但通过不断的技术改进和用户教育,SMTP-AUTH认证将继续在邮件安全领域发挥重要作用。希望通过本文的介绍,大家能对SMTP-AUTH认证有更深入的了解,并在实际应用中更好地保护自己的邮件通信安全。